P3, Lap 84 of 85. Blanchimont - sparks flying, spray from the damp track. Over 3 hours behind the wheel at this point, the rain is heavier, the track slippier - and all on a set of soft slicks that had been on the car since lap 30!
Bus-stop chicane. Darren Adams (P2) and Graydon (P3) about to have the slightest of touches. Graydon took P2 at this point with Adams tucking in after a small slide as a result. Graydon apologised after race, confirming in car he felt no contact.
Out of Les Combes and heading for Rivage. P5 Mraz; P6 Graydon; P7 Jackson; P8 Montour. For the first few laps it was this close around a damp Spa Francorchamps!
Early battle for P12 - after several laps of close racing Graydon finally passes Van Staden into Turn 1 after getting a nice slipstream down the long main straight
